Ariz. Admin. Code § R19-3-564 - Dismissal Before Hearing

A. The Director may dismiss, upon written determination, an appeal in whole or in part before scheduling a hearing if:
1. The appeal does not state a valid basis for protest,
2. The appeal is untimely as prescribed under R19-3-558, or
3. The appeal attempts to raise issues not raised in the protest.
B. The procurement officer shall notify the interested party in writing of a determination to dismiss an appeal before hearing.

New Section R19-3-564 renumbered from R19-3-556 by final rulemaking at 19 A.A.C. 1641, effective August 4, 2013 (Supp. 13-2). Renumbered from R19-3-563 final rulemaking at 22 A.A.R. 2966, effective 11/21/2016.
